E-Locker Factory Switch Wiring Help Needed

I bought a complete drum to drum rear which I put in last week. I also have the e-locker ecu as well as the factory switch. My problem is, that my 4runner does not have a prewired plug that goes into the e-locker factory button. What are my options! I really want to be able to use this factory button, and I don't really want to run a new wiring harness (ABS+locker). I have read in detail, many times, the sanoransteel e-locker retrofit, but that writeup had a prewired 4runner. That writeup did have a wiring schematic included, but I'm not sure how to make my factory E-locker button work. Thanks in advance!

Be nice to know where you Are??

Do you have a multimeter?? If this answer is no You are already in over your head.

Since not all of us have the elocker rears or controls handy pictures or a least a good description might help.

Should be pretty simple to figure out. Are you sure that part of the harness is not just tied up since the switch was never installed.

Most Toyota wire harnesses have the wiring for all the options except for the switches and the items they would control.

One just never knows. If it is not there you need to build your own harness for your new goodie . no other way to do it.
